Adam Airport is an air base and proposed domestic airport[1] situated in the Adam wilayah of the Ad Dakhiliyah Region of Oman. The air base is 18 kilometres (11 mi) northwest of the town of Adam.
Runway length does not include 360 metres (1,180 ft) displaced thresholds on each end. The Izki VOR-DME (Ident: IZK) is located 31.7 nautical miles (59 km) northeast of the airport.[2] A VOR-DME is located on the field.[3]
